Delhi a stalking capital now: Abhishek Manu Singhvi

New Delhi , 21 Sep 2016

The Congress on Wednesday condemned the attack on a 21-year-old woman in Delhi and slammed the central government, dubbing Delhi as "stalking capital of India"."We express grave concern, sorrow and anger at the kind of situation developing in Delhi and in India regarding the stalking of women," Congress spokesperson Abhishek Manu Singhvi told reporters here."Delhi is being talked of as the stalking capital of India. It is a title that it can do without," he said.The Congress leader's remarks came a day after a young woman was brutally attacked and killed in broad daylight in north Delhi's Burari area by a jilted lover.

The assailant identified as Surender Singh, 34, stabbed the woman with a scissor on Tuesday morning for over 22 times in full public view. A 28-year-old woman, a mother of two, was stabbed by a 26-year-old jilted lover in west Delhi's Inderpuri area on Monday."What is happening is shocking and brutal. It's occurring in broad daylight," he alleged.Taking a dig at the Bharatiya Janata Party-led National Democratic Alliance (NDA) states for leading in crime against women, Singhvi said, "Figures suggest three worst areas in crimes against women are in NDA-governed state.""Maharashtra and Telengana follow Delhi in crimes against women. In Delhi, crimes of stalking have doubled," he added.
